Step 1: Gather Ingredients
Maseca
Maseca is a popular brand of masa harina, which is a type of corn flour used in traditional Mexican cooking. Make sure to have Maseca on hand before starting to make gorditas.
Water
Water is a key ingredient in making gorditas with Maseca. You will need water to mix with the Maseca to form the dough for the gorditas.
Salt
Salt is used to season the dough for the gorditas. Be sure to have salt available to add flavor to your gorditas.
Step 2: Prepare the Dough
Mix Maseca and water
To start making gorditas with Maseca, you will need to mix the Maseca (corn flour) with water. The ratio of Maseca to water may vary depending on the recipe, but a common ratio is 2 cups of Maseca to 1 1/4 cups of water. Slowly pour the water into the Maseca while stirring until a dough-like consistency is formed.
Knead the dough
Once the Maseca and water are mixed together, it’s time to knead the dough. Use your hands to knead the dough until it is smooth and all the ingredients are well incorporated. This step is important to ensure that the gorditas come out soft and fluffy.
Let it rest
After kneading the dough, cover it with a damp cloth or plastic wrap and let it rest for about 15-20 minutes. Allowing the dough to rest will help it relax and make it easier to work with when shaping the gorditas later on. This step also helps develop the flavors in the dough, resulting in a more delicious final product.
Step 3: Shape the Gorditas
Divide the dough
First, take a small portion of the dough and divide it into smaller pieces. This will make it easier to shape the gorditas and ensure they cook evenly.
Form small discs
Next, take each piece of dough and flatten it into a small disc shape. Use your hands to gently press down on the dough until it is about 1/4 inch thick. Make sure the edges are smooth and even.
Create a pocket
To create the signature pocket of a gordita, carefully fold the flattened dough in half, pressing the edges together to seal it shut. This pocket will later be filled with delicious ingredients like refried beans, cheese, or shredded meat.

Step 4: Cook the Gorditas
Heat a skillet or griddle
Before cooking the gorditas, make sure to heat up a skillet or griddle on medium heat. This will ensure that the gorditas cook evenly and develop a nice golden crust.
Cook each side
Place the gorditas on the skillet or griddle and cook for about 2-3 minutes on each side. You will know they are ready when they are slightly puffed up and have a nice golden color.
Serve hot
Once the gorditas are cooked to perfection, remove them from the skillet or griddle and serve them hot. You can enjoy them plain or fill them with your favorite toppings such as beans, cheese, or salsa. Enjoy your homemade gorditas made with Maseca!
